Anthony S. Chan resigns as COO; Lim Sheng Hon Danny appointed new COO

On February 8, 2024, Lim Sheng Hon Danny was appointed as Chief Operating Officer of the Company by the Company’s Board of Directors.

On February 6, 2024, Anthony S. Chan resigned as Chief Operating Officer of HWH International Inc. (the “Company”), effective immediately, due to personal reasons.
